Coast Guard medevacs 31-year-old man from Carnival Sunshine near Port Canaveral
JACKSONVILLE, Fla. — The Coast Guard medevaced a 31-year-old man Tuesday from the cruise ship Carnival Sunshine near Port Canaveral.
Coast Guard Sector Jacksonville Command Center watchstanders received a call at 10:20 p.m. from the crew of the cruise ship Carnival Sunshine stating a passenger was in need of a higher level of medical care.
A Coast Guard Station Port Canaveral 45-foot Response Boat – Medium (RBM) crew launched at 11:07 p.m. with EMS on board.
The RBM crew arrived with the Carnival Sunshine at 12:07 a.m., embarked the passenger and nurse and transported them to Jetty Park where EMS were waiting.
The passenger was taken to Health First Cape Canaveral Hospital for further medical treatment.
